Peak Design Everyday Backpack V2 Photo Backpack 20 liters
Often on tour and still a lot of equipment? No problem with the Everyday V2 Backpack from Peak Design! 20 liters of capacity swallow even larger photo equipment without problems, which can be safely stored with the help of the padded FlexFold dividers. And whatever else you need for everyday use remains well organized and separable from the photo equipment thanks to practical access points in the individually configurable interior. With the "update" of the Everyday Line to version 2 (V2), the series also presents itself in a new look.

Fast access, secure interior
The chic, minimalist design literally has it all - with the Everyday Backpack series, Peak Design has developed some highly innovative solutions that reliably protect the interior of the backpack while still allowing access to the photo equipment in seconds. This works in two ways: Once conventionally via the lid flap, which can be closed with the MagLatch closure system, an excellently thought-out solution for effective protection that has already proven itself in the Messenger Bags. Here, the closure flap houses a metal closure hook with matching anchor bars on the front of the backpack. Unlike most backpacks, Peak Design has thereby considered different "filling levels": there are namely 4 anchor bars, stably riveted, in which the closure hook can be hooked. If the backpack is fully loaded, you simply take the top bar, if it is rather empty, a deeper. The flap closure and hook are also magnetic. This means that the backpack can be reliably closed without snapping the hook.

Side access
The second option also fundamentally distinguishes the Everyday Backpack from other, photo backpacks: In addition to the lid flap, there is also a zippered opening on both sides of the backpack. This eliminates the biggest disadvantage of conventional backpacks with access from the top - you no longer have to dig through the contents! At the same time, this clever detail greatly increases the everyday usability of the backpack: when you're carrying not only your photo gear, but also everyday items or luggage. In the Everyday Backpack, you can configure the interior individually (more on this below) and thus easily store both separately from each other - and also access them independently through the two side openings. You can also pull the backpack in front of your body from the right side to access camera gear in the right main compartment, for example, while everyday items stay safely in the left half of the backpack and don't get in the way. Comfortable, uncomplicated adjustable carrying straps help with this. And since the backpack's outer shell is also made entirely of 100% recycled, weather-resistant nylon, the contents will stay dry even if you're headed to Scotland in the fall.

Adaptable: plenty of room for camera and Lenses
The large main compartment is also adaptable: with three Velcro dividers that can be individually placed and folded, it adapts entirely to the needs of your photo gear, making it suitable for any type of camera - from mirrorless system cameras of all sizes to full-frame SLRs. Of course, what ultimately fits in the backpack depends on the size of your camera and lenses. A possible lineup would be a DSLR camera with one lens attached, two to three interchangeable lenses, and a clip-on flash. Larger DSLM cameras like the various models in the Sony a7 series or a Fuji X-T2 still leave room for more lenses. In addition, you can still stow a lot of accessories. And those who have a small DSLM camera (MFT cameras from Olympus, Fujifilm X-A or E series) can use the backpack for their equipment and for non-photographic things. Drone pilots also make an optimal choice with the Everyday Backpack 20L, because the backpack offers enough space for a DJI Mavic Pro including remote control and accessories.

Optimal fit and high wearing comfort
A removable chest strap provides even more wearing comfort if required. With this, the two carrying straps are connected and then hold each other in position. Thus, the backpack sits optimally on the body without slipping. The chest strap is hooked into the carrying straps with aluminum hooks. In addition, a length-adjustable hip belt is available as a separate accessory. This transfers some of the backpack's weight to the hip area to further relieve back strain.

Versatile extra compartments
A tablet and laptop compartment securely holds devices with a screen diagonal of up to 15 inches. Thanks to two separate sleeves, documents or even a second device can be transported in addition to the tablet or laptop. There are also several small slip-in compartments in the inner lining - messy batteries, memory cards and cables are a thing of the past with the Everyday Backpack. These compartments either have zippers or are even self-closing thanks to a mini magnet in the lining. More luggage than planned? No need to worry! With the included Cord Hook carrying straps, the bag gets additional carrying capacity: simply snap the adjustable carrying loops to the side. Tripods and other items can be securely attached to the outside and carried along. When you're not using this feature, the tethers can be stored in a hidden storage compartment.

The FlexFold dividers - Clever folding design for individual adjustment
Almost a trademark of Peak Design: Unlike other backpacks, the Everydays can be divided and adjusted even more flexibly. The trick behind it: the FlexFold dividers! The developers of Peak Design have based the concept on Japanese origami techniques. With this innovative design of two layers of fabric, the one-piece is not only simply foldable, but doubly unfoldable: one layer of the divider can be folded down, while the other layer remains unfolded. So you get a kind of shelf with an intermediate bottom. The divider can support a long Lens and at the same time separate two Lenses stacked on top of each other - a multitude of storage possibilities. Of course, you can also remove the FlexFold dividers altogether - so the Everyday Backpack adapts to your everyday needs.

Attachment option for a capture clip on each strap
Both straps have an attachment option for a separately available Peak Design Capture Clip. This ensures that the camera is reliably secured and immediately within reach.

More details
Peak Design also has the little things in mind. Among the many details are an inside pocket for sunglasses and an AnchorLink clip in the sheath as a secure anchor point for your keychain! Additionally, there are loops on the outside for the two Cord Hook tethers, which, as mentioned earlier, can be used to securely tie down things that are too bulky for the interior. Such details optimize the backpack for photo use and increase its utility in everyday life. Waterproof DWR impregnation and weather-resistant zippers with shutters and safety tabs make the bag fit for harsh environments, while soft cotton blend fabric as the inner material gives a high-quality feel.
